Aguyi-Ironsi suspended the constitution and dissolved parliament. He then abolished the regional confederated form of government and pursued unitary like policies favored by the NCNC, having apparently been influenced by some NCNC political philosophy.

Ironsi did not abolish regional government rather he promulgated decree 34 which is unification of federal civil service. If he abolished regional government, why did he appoint regional governors? The regional government was abolished by Gowon who replaced it with state government.


[color=#] Ironsi fatally did not bring the failed plotters to trial as required by then-military law and as advised by most northern and western officers, rather, coup plotters were maintained in the military on full pay and some were even promoted while apparently awaiting trial..[/color]

You have written like a person who shuns the use of research apparatus. The 1963 Nigerian constitution and military code of conduct never stipulated that coup plotters have to be shot. The heaviest term was mere imprisonment after the Military Judge-advocate has determined their culpability. However before the military judge could have his/her hand on the case, the case should be made by the armed forces panel constituted by the GOC. In this case Ironsi had appointed a three-man panel that consisted of Gowon, Bala Usman and MD Yusuf. Be mindful that the panel was made up by people from the northern region of Nigeria. Instead of these goons to find the facts and proceed to the process of court-marshal, they were busy planning a counter-coup. Again it was goofy Obasanjo and fellow goons that introduced the killing of coup plotters in Nigeria after the deletion of Murtala Muhammed in 1975. It was very ironical that when the goofy Obasanjo was implicated in coup, he cried river.

Back to our business, Awo was released in August 4 1966, just 6 days to the counter coup that killed Ironsi. How in the world will Ojukwu have control over the eastern region when Gowon even hold power over Nigeria including the Eastern region up till 1967 when he proclaimed division of state into twelve.


The decision to release Awolowo was made by the supreme military council under Ironsi not Gowon. By the way, Ironsi was killed in the countercoup of July 29, 1966.

[color=#990000]The counter-coup led to the installation of Lieutenant-Colonel Yakubu Gowon as Supreme Commander of the Nigerian Armed Forces.[/color]

Gowon never agreed to being a member of the coup. In addition, coup of July 29, 1966 was not a total success because there was a military commander that did not recognize Gowon's imposition as leader of Nigeria. The military commander insisted on the correct military parlance where the chief of staff supreme military HQ, who for intents and practical purposes was 2ic (second in command) to Ironsi to be head of state in absensce of Ironsi. The impasse in the Nigeria leadership led to reconciliation talks in Aburi, Ghana.
